2.7.1.1 Objectives, Rationale, Target Groups and<br />
Instruments<br />
On September 4th 2006 the government adopted the “Strategy<br />
for Increasing the Innovativeness of the Economy, 2007-<br />
2013” that identified the need of support for clusters. The Polish<br />
government considers the support of clusters as “an important<br />
component element in several spheres of economic policy,<br />
most especially those connected with innovation, regional development<br />
and industry”. 70 A specific feature of cluster policy<br />
in Poland is the interest of the government in linking clusters<br />
and cluster policy more closely with the development of special<br />
economic zones. 71 These <strong>are</strong> <strong>are</strong>as in which business activity<br />
may be conducted under preferential conditions defined<br />
by the Act on Special Economic Zones of 20 October 1994. 72<br />
The support of clusters is provided by a set of different grant<br />
funding and technical assistance programs respectively<br />
projects. They include:<br />
• The Innovative Economy Operational Program,<br />
Measure 5.1 “Support of the Development of supr<strong>are</strong>gional<br />
clusters”, addresses cluster coordinators to<br />
support investments, training, advisory services and<br />
internationalization activities. The budget of this program<br />
(only Measure 5.1 of the Innovative Economy Operational<br />
Program is EUR 104.3 million in the period 2007-2013).<br />
The overall objective of this measure is to support the<br />
development of national clusters and to enhance the competitive<br />
position of companies through supporting collaborative<br />
relationships between companies and between<br />
companies and business environment institutions, including<br />
scientific institutes. Support is available to coordinators of<br />
such collaborations (cluster coordinators) who do not operate<br />
for profit or allocate the profit for objectives relating to<br />
tasks pursued by the Polish Agency for Enterprise Development.<br />
Beneficiary may be a foundation, registered association,<br />
joint-stock company, limited-liability company, R&D<br />
institution or an organization of entrepreneurs. To be eligible<br />
a project should involve at least 10 companies of which <strong>are</strong><br />
at least 50 per cent SME and at least one R&D institution and<br />
one business support institution. In order to facilitate the<br />
development of supra-regional clusters project participants<br />
have to come from at least two voivodeships (provinces) and<br />
their total sh<strong>are</strong> in sales outside this region must be at least<br />
30 percent.<br />
The maximum amount of co-financing per project (can be<br />
up to 100 per cent of total project costs) is EUR 5 million (PLN<br />
20 million) for investments, EUR 250,000 (PLN 1 million) for<br />
training that is related to the investments, 5 per cent of the<br />
total eligible expenditure for operational and administrative<br />
expenses, EUR 100,000 (PLN 400,000) for advisory services.<br />
